Itinerario
Svegliatevi presto per assistere al meglio a questa meraviglia naturale. Tra le 3:45 e le 4:15, verremo a prendervi dal vostro hotel per un giro panoramico a sud di Cusco, passando attraverso pittoresche valli e villaggi andini tradizionali. Dopo circa due ore, raggiungeremo Cusipata (3.329 m s.l.m.), dove gusteremo la colazione prima di proseguire in furgone verso le montagne. Lungo la strada, passeremo mandrie di alpaca e lama e vedremo i pastori locali svolgere le loro routine quotidiane. La nostra escursione inizia a Phuluwasipata, con una salita di due ore al Rainbow Mountain (5,020 m s.l.m.). In vetta, rimarrai stupito dai vivaci colori minerali e dalle viste panoramiche mozzafiato sulle cime andine circostanti. Dopo una pausa di 30 minuti per riposare e gustare uno spuntino, scenderemo per 1,5 ore di nuovo a Phuluwasipata. Da lì, il nostro trasporto ci porterà in un ristorante vicino per un meritato pranzo prima di tornare a Cusco, arrivando tra le 16:00 e le 18:00, a seconda del ritmo del gruppo.

This was a day trip that my wife and I added to our Peru trip as a last minute add-on. We traveled by private car from Cusco to the Rainbow Mountain trail head. We had a private guide (Percy) and a driver. Percy was very friendly and willing to share the history of the areas we traveled thru, the culture of the people and tips for managing the actual hike itself. He was very attentive to our needs and made us feel very safe and secure throughout the trip. The location is simply amazing. The trip is at high altitude. You start at about 15,000ft and finish at 16,500ft. The trail is very easy though, well marked and not technical at all. We also stopped along the way at a local place for breakfast and lunch. The staff and food were great. Overall I would highly recommend this to someone that has the time and is traveling in the area.
